Most probably you don’t know anything about the origin of a portable table saw, which was actually invented in 1929. Art Emmons, the Porter-Cable engineer was the author of that idea. He introduced a compact and lightweight design of a typical circular saw of that time. Certainly since then the portable table saws have been continuously improved in the design and performance. As a result they are the more advanced and lighter alternatives offered on the contemporary market.

Benchtop table saw
The benchtop saw is first type of the portable table saws. They are small in size and lightweight, generally not more than 40 or 50 pounds, to carry from one location to another. It is designed to be placed on a table or other support for operation as it has no stands attached. This tool can be used as a portable option at any jobsite. But more often this type of saw is used by homeowners and DIY enthusiasts in home workshops or facilities that are tight on space.
Small pieces of furniture like coffee tables, chairs or light constructions can be made from the materials cut on this type of saws. Dewalt DW745 benchtop table saw is one of the best options in this class of equipment.
The benchtop table saws commonly have a direct-drive motor. This means that the motor power can be transferred directly to the blade. Thus less horsepower is needed to accomplish the desired job.
One of the flipsides is that the table surface is comparably small that limits the rip capacity. That is why these saws are less functional than larger and more powerful options. Besides they have a shorter rip fence, which makes it harder to make a clean and straight cut when ripping.
Such saws are often made from cheaper materials such as plastic or aluminum and usually come with a more simple design with fewer components than full size table saws. And this contributes to their attractively lower price in comparison with large stationary models.
Jobsite table saw
The jobsite saws are a bit larger and heavier than the benchtop models, and are mounted on a folding or stationary stand which often comes with wheels. Because of this feature they are still referred to the portable type of table saws. These saws are mostly used by professional carpenters, contractors, and home woodworkers for making pieces of furniture or materials for house construction, etc.
Commonly the jobsite saws are run by the powerful 15 amp universal motors. However many of the advanced models are equipped with gear-driven motors. The design of such tools is stronger with the larger table surface enhancing the ripping capacity. They are made of better quality materials, so the parts like the fence are sturdier and more reliable. They provide more accuracy while cutting than the benchtop saws with an overall higher functionality. Dewalt DWE7491RS is a bright example which demonstrates the above-mentioned features.
Jobsite table saws also come with the additional accessories like riving knives and dust collection included in the scope of supply. However if you buy a cheaper saw you will probably have to purchase those items separately. Most of these saws are more expensive than the benchtop models.

Portable vs. Stationary table saws | Main Features
- Portability
Obviously it is the main advantage of the portable table saws over the stationary counterparts. These saws are made to be transferred and stored easily. Besides, the portable models can be very handy if your working space is limited, and you have to maneuver the saw around. Due to the compactness and lightweight of the smaller tools you are able to work both indoors and outdoors.
The stationary table saws are heavy and bulky machines which are installed whether on a fixed base with an enclosed cabinet or on a robust stand. Thus, they are highly limited in mobility and take up a lot of space. Besides they feature a large surface tables or an extension table, as an additional option for some models, which enhance the productivity but lower considerably the possibility of their handling around any facility.
- Power
The portable table saws run at lower power ratings and thus require lower voltage for operation. It is very convenient for the regular customers to run the saw by the standard residential 120-volt power outlet. While the most powerful stationary models like cabinet or sliding table saws are equipped with extremely powerful 3-5 HP motors and capable to run only by the industrial-grade 240-volt power supply. It should be a matter of concern for a carpenter or craftsman who deals with minor woodworking projects or use it from time to time.
- Capacity
Despite the simple design, nowadays the portable table saws are versatile and indispensable tools for multiple woodworking jobs and DIY crafts. It offers a great convenience and consistency in use for the operators. They can be useful both for small and large-scale projects. They perform as the main tool applied for smaller woodworking or DIY jobs or construction of houses with a light wooden framework. However, the professionals often use it as auxiliary equipment for minor stuff.
The stationary table saws are designed to handle large stock mainly. In particular, they will not perform better on softwood or thin plywood.

Trusted Brands
DeWALT
DeWALT is a well-known US brand with a history of almost 100 years. The company now belongs to a part of the Stanley Black & Decker group. DeWALT offers a wide range of hand and power tools designed for the woodworking, manufacturing, and construction industries. Their products include table, miter, reciprocating, circular saws, and other types of the advanced cutting tools.
According to the customers’ reviews, the DeWALT products demonstrate the excellent quality, especially in terms of durability and functionality. This brand can be associated with reliability which you can trust without any doubts.
Bosch
Bosch Group is one of the largest engineering companies in the world. They’re also a major power tool manufacturer with a strong reputation worldwide. According to the customers’ reviews their products are considered to be highly reliable, featuring advanced and innovating characteristics. The company has multiple production facilities around the world with a global selling network.
As the company declares, each year they launch more than 100 new power tools into the global market that is quite impressive.
Grizzly Industrial, Inc.
The company was established in 1983 in the U.S.A. They provide high quality woodworking and metalworking machinery and accessories. The Company offers table saws, metal and wood band saws, wood lathes, surface grinders, etc. Grizzly Industrial Inc. serves the customers worldwide. Their products are highly appreciated by the customers for the quality and value.
Makita Corporation
Makita Corporation was founded in 1915 in Japan as an electric motor sales and repair company. Nowadays the company is recognized as the manufacturer of portable power tools. The latter are made in numerous factories in Japan, the United States, the United Kingdom, Brazil, and other countries. The customers trust their American-made quality which is considered to be one of the best in the world.
SKIL
The SKIL brand was established in 1926 in the US. Nowadays Skil Power Tools is a worldwide manufacturer of power driven hand tools and accessories. The company now focuses more on the DIY customers, nevertheless offering the range of the industrial and professional-grade equipment on the market. Skil products include table saws, jig and reciprocating saws, multiple sanders, grinders, hammers, drills, mixers, lasers, measuring tools, and many others.
The brand was a part of the Bosch Group for many years. However, it offers tools at a slightly lower price in comparison with Bosch counterparts, but still featuring a reliable quality for the specific applications.
